The Guild Wars series is a set of fantasy online role-playing games published by NCsoft. The core games use a buy-to-play business model with no recurring subscription fees. The games are focused on player vs. player combat and story-driven co-op playing.
Aardwolf is a fantasy-themed MUD (multi-user dungeon) game that allows users to explore a text-based world, fight monsters, complete quests, and interact with other players. It offers customizable gameplay with features like clans, player housing, crafting, and player-versus-player combat.
